Clever Woman Forger Paffles Plays Many Roles Across Sound Cities

A Tacoma Star report portrays a roving forger known as Paffles who operates across the Sound cities. She uses a child and a shadowy husband to aid her forgery schemes, cashing bogus checks in Whatcom, Everett, Ellensburg, Tacoma, and other towns. In Ellensburg she appeared as a rancher’s wife, in Whatcom as a cowboy’s wife, in Tacoma as an ex cabinet-maker’s wife, adapting to local settings to swindle victims.

Wheat Theft Suspect Arrested in Northern Pacific Case

P. J. Flynn, yardmaster for the Northern Pacific, was arrested on larceny charges after four of five wheat cars transferred from the Great Northern to NP went missing. A carload valued near $1,000 was found unloaded at Arlington dock. A former shipping employee aided the arrest, with more arrests anticipated as officials suspect a conspiracy. Blaze in Bed Room at 1st Sixth Avenue

A fire in the top floor apartment of G. W. Wheaton at 1st Sixth Avenue destroyed most bedroom furnishings before Fire Company No 1 arrived at 6 30 yesterday evening. The chemical engine quickly controlled the blaze. A dropped lit match among pillows caused the fire.

Nome Capitalists Prep $150000 Alaska Exhibit for World’s Fair

The Alaska Gold Nugget Company prepares a major display for the St Louis World’s Fair to showcase Alaska gold nuggets jewelry ivory furs and curios valued at about 156000. The exhibit features three of Nome’s largest gold nuggets and nugget stacks totaling 35000 along with substantial nugget jewelry. The collection largely resides in Seattle banks awaiting transport.

Salmon Men to Hold a Convention in Beattie

A congress of representative salmon packers and fishermen will meet in Beattie the week starting February 2. Led by H C Faswett of the U S Bureau of Fisheries, the event has government interest and aims to form a permanent association with annual conventions. The Fraser River hatchery proposal will be discussed.

Suspect Arrested In Saloon Robbery Plot

Flowers was arrested by Sergeant Leighton yesterday afternoon while attempting to borrow a revolver and blackjack to rob Reen Heycock's saloon at 144 Washington Street. He sought weapons at a second hand store on Washington Street and promised to return with money after the hold up.

Death of Pioneer David Munroe in Seattle

David Munroe aged three died yesterday at the family residence on Blanchard avenue after years of ill health. He leaves a wife and adopted daughter, a brother John Munroe of Whatcom, and a sister in Scotland. Munroe accumulated property after arriving in Seattle and built the Munroe block on First avenue.
